Prindi objekt ekraanile - CSS-trikid

Anonim

PHP-l on kena print_r funktsioon muutuja kohta teabe ekraanile printimiseks. console.log () on selle jaoks suurepärane ka JavaScripti jaoks, kuid mõnikord peate / soovite seda lihtsalt ekraanil vaadata.

function print_r(o) ( return JSON.stringify(o,null,'\t').replace(/\n/g,'
').replace(/\t/g,' '); )

Nii et kui teil on mõni selline objekt:

var myObject = ( "lunch": "sandwich", "dinner": "stirfry" );

Sa võiksid teha järgmist:

var putHere = document.getElementById("#put-here"); putHere.innerHTML = print_r(myObject);

tulemuse kuvamiseks ekraanil.

Samuti on console.table () sellisteks asjadeks mõnikord palju parem kui console.log ().